DataCert Adds QuickInvoice to Its Product Line

Web-based Invoice Submission Tool Allows Corporate Legal Departments to Monitor All Outside Legal Expenses

HOUSTON, April 28, 2005 - DataCert, Inc., the leading provider of electronic invoicing and legal spend management solutions, today announced the addition of QuickInvoice to its product line. A module of ShareDoc®, DataCert's proprietary web-based invoice subscription service, QuickInvoice allows 100 percent of a corporation's law firms and vendors to send and receive legal invoices electronically.

"We were looking for a total solution that would enable all of our law firms and legal vendors to submit their invoices to us electronically," said Kevin Harrang, Deputy General Counsel, Microsoft Corporation. "With the addition of QuickInvoice to its product line, we believe that DataCert provides us with the 100% electronic solution that we need to better manage our legal spend around the globe."

How It Works

QuickInvoice is simple to use and requires nothing more than a browser. Users log onto the website, select a corporate client, enter invoice-level header information as well as summary information for fees, expenses, and/or discounts, attach an electronic copy of the invoice or backup documentation (as required by the corporate client), and submit through the website directly to the corporate client. Once the invoice is submitted, the user can track and monitor the status of invoice for delivery and approval.

Invoices successfully submitted via QuickInvoice are automatically entered into the corporate client's workflow for invoice processing and payment procedures. Once an invoice is submitted, the corporate client has immediate access to review, adjust, and approve the invoice. When the invoice is delivered or rejected, an email is sent notifying the law firm/vendor; however, a user can also check the status of an invoice at any time within QuickInvoice.

On average, 80 percent of a corporation's outside law firms and vendors submit invoices electronically, commented John Gilman, Director, Product Management, DataCert. "The remaining 20 percent are paper invoices. These paper invoices don't typically get entered into the matter management system, making it difficult to get a true picture of a corporation's total outside counsel spend. QuickInvoice eliminates this issue, allowing all law firms to create, submit, and track summary-level invoices."

Many corporate clients also require backup documentation for invoices. QuickInvoice allows a user to submit electronic invoices or supporting documentation. The type of attachments allowed is determined by the corporate legal department, but commonly accepted formats are: Adobe Acrobat files (.pdf) and Tagged Image File (.tif) files.
